Risks and Considerations of Cloud-Based Solutions

While cloud-based solutions offer numerous benefits, they do carry some risks. One primary concern is the potential impact on business operations during outages. Reliance on fast internet connectivity is crucial, as a lack thereof can interrupt critical processes. Careful consideration of service level agreements, data security, and backup solutions becomes paramount to effectively mitigate these risks.

Benefits of Cloud Technology in Data Storage

Data storage is an area that significantly benefits from cloud technology. By leveraging the cloud, organizations can overcome the limitations of physical storage, scale their data storage capabilities seamlessly, ensure data redundancy, and enhance accessibility. Embracing cloud-based data storage solutions can lead to improved data management, reduced costs, and increased efficiency.

Enabling Digital Transformation for Smaller Labs

Cloud infrastructure plays a pivotal role in facilitating the digital transformation journey for smaller and mid-sized labs. The cloud offers cost-effective scalability, robust security measures, and access to a wide range of digital tools and applications. By harnessing cloud infrastructure, smaller labs can effectively compete with larger counterparts, overcome resource constraints, and delve into the world of digital innovation.
